Output 56b509017d035968b338cb0c6c628981c92e1ceffeeee205903c9a60a81fb039:1

value
178578925
script pubkey
OP_0 OP_PUSHBYTES_20 53ae5db91b39e7ebeb2fded660df2fedba245562
address
bc1q2wh9mwgm88n7h6e0mmtxphe0akazg4tz9tmzhs
transaction
56b509017d035968b338cb0c6c628981c92e1ceffeeee205903c9a60a81fb039
spent
true